Preparation method of metal-base ceramic composite filter membrane

The invention discloses a preparation method of a metal-base ceramic composite filter membrane. The method includes steps: firstly, uniformly coating powder on the surface of a porous matrix, and obtaining a porous metal membrane layer by means of sintering; secondly, soaking the porous metal membrane layer into electrolyte to be anodized and obtaining a transition layer; thirdly, adding oxide powder into dispersing agent to obtain coating liquid; fourthly, coating the coating liquid onto the transition layer and sintering the transition layer after the transition layer is dried; and fifthly,repeating the fourth step for a product after being sintered until a porous ceramic filtering membrane with the thickness ranging from 2mum to 80mum is obtained, and obtaining the metal-base ceramic composite filtering membrane. The problem that bonding is not firm enough when metal and ceramic are compounded is resolved, the effective transition layer is formed on the metal matrix, so that a ceramic layer is firmly bonded with the metal matrix, processability of the prepared composite filter membrane is good, and the composite filter membrane can be used for preparing filtering devices in various shapes, simultaneously, has excellent chemical attack resistance, is high in pressure resistance and stable in repeatability, and can be used as a key component for micro-nano filtering and separating.

Preparation method for ultrasound-assisted fiber surface expanding of nonwoven cloth and loading with nano zinc oxide

The invention relates to a method for ultrasound-assisted fiber surface expanding of nonwoven cloth and loading with nano zinc oxide. The method includes the steps: 1) mixing evenly a cellulose nanocrystal suspension and a zinc salt solution, putting the mixed solution into an ultrasonic generator, and heating in water bath; 2) putting the nonwoven cloth into the mixed solution, carrying out ultrasonic heating for 0.1-3 h at the temperature of 40-100 DEG C, after the reaction is finished, taking out the nonwoven cloth, putting the nonwoven cloth into an alkali liquid, impregnating, then taking out the nonwoven cloth, and drying; and 3) adding ammonia water into a zinc salt solution until the pH of the solution is 10-12, to obtain a zinc ammonia solution; and putting the dried nonwoven cloth into the zinc ammonia solution, carrying out hot and cold alternating impregnation for 1-100 cycles, taking out the nonwoven cloth, and drying to obtain the product. Nano zinc oxide with different topological structures are evenly loaded on the surface of the nonwoven fabric fibers, easy agglomeration, difficult recovery and difficult preparation of pure nano zinc oxide particles are effectively avoided, the whole preparation process has no pollution to the environment, and the method is suitable for industrial scale production.

Preparation method of one-dimensional silicon nanowires with different linear densities

The invention discloses a preparation method of one-dimensional silicon nanowires with different linear densities. The method includes following steps of, a, preprocessing a silicon chip; b, preparing a one-dimensional silicon nanowire array by means of a metal catalysis etching method; and c, performing postprocessing, wherein the metal catalysis etching method includes two steps of, step one, depositing silver nanoparticles: impregnating the preprocessed silicon chip in an HF-AgNO3 mixed aqueous solution for 20-40 seconds, the concentration of HF is 0.1-0.2 mol / L, and the concentration of AgNO3 is 0.008-0.012 mol / L; and step two, performing metal assisted etching: immersing the silicon chip obtained from the step one into an HF-H2O2 mixed etching solution, and performing etching for 20-40 minutes under a room temperature. According to the preparation method of the one-dimensional silicon nanowires with the different linear densities, the photoelectric properties of the prepared one-dimensional silicon nanowire array are obviously improved in ultraviolet diffuse reflection, photocurrent characteristics and photocatalysis reaction, technological parameters can be adjusted to control shapes and densities of the silicon nanowires, and the preparation method is simple, low in cost and pollution-free.

Preparation method of CdS/Cd2Ge2O6 hetrojunction photocatalyst in response to visible light

The invention discloses a preparation method of a CdS / Cd2Ge2O6 hetrojunction photocatalyst in response to visible light and belongs to the technical field of environmental pollution control. The preparation method is characterized in that Cd2Ge2O6 and Cd(AC)2.2H2O are prepared by a solvent-thermal method under the condition of a mixed solvent of deionized water and anhydrous alcohol; and then the CdS / Cd2Ge2O6 hetrojunction photocatalyst in response to the visible light is prepared by adopting an ion exchange method and is used for visible light catalytic degradation of methylene blue as a dye pollutant and bisphenol A as an endocrine disruptor. The preparation method has the advantages of simpleness in operation, stable performance, high degradation efficiency, no generation of other pollutants in the preparation process and the like and has very high practical value and an application prospect.

Spherical graphene/FePO4 composite and preparing method thereof

The invention discloses a spherical graphene/FePO4 composite and a preparing method thereof. The preparing method includes the following steps of (1) preparing an aqueous solution of ferric salt and a phosphorous compound; 2, adding the aqueous solution and an alkaline solution into a reactor kettle in a parallel-flow mode, keeping the pH being 2-4 and the temperature being 20-90 DEG C, and obtaining primary-growth graphene/FePO4.2H2O; 3, concentrating and dispersing the prepared primary-growth graphene/FePO4.2H2O into the reaction kettle, repeating operation in the step 2, and obtaining a secondary-growth spherical graphene/FePO4.2H2O composite through suction filtration, washing and drying; 4, sintering the prepared secondary-growth graphene/FePO4.2H2O composite under inert gas to obtain the spherical graphene/FePO4 composite. According to the spherical graphene/FePO4 composite and the preparing method, graphene is directly introduced into preparing of FePO4, and particles of the prepared spherical graphene/FePO4 composite are regular in shape, even in granularity and high in tap density. The whole preparing technology is rapid and convenient to operate, and the spherical graphene/FePO4 composite and the preparing method are of great application significance in preparing of a graphene/lithium iron phosphate composite.

Quaternary ammonium salt compound disinfectant and preparation method thereof

The invention provides a quaternary ammonium salt compound disinfectant and a preparation method thereof, which belong to the technical field of disinfectants. A compound synergistic principle is adopted, benzalkonium chloride and polyhexamethylene biguanide which belong to the same cationic surfactant are compounded into a compound disinfectant, strong electropositivity is generated by ionizationin an aqueous solution, bacteria and viruses with negative charges can be adsorbed, and coconut oil fatty acid diethanolamide and glycerol are cooperatively used, positive charges ionized by benzalkonium chloride and polyhexamethylene biguanide are promoted to penetrate through cell walls, so that bacteria and viruses can be killed, and great danger to the safety of people and influence on the environment are avoided. The quaternary ammonium salt compound disinfectant provided by the invention has the advantages of easily available raw materials, easily operated preparation process, low production cost, no corrosion to human and object surfaces, no odor, no toxicity, environmental protection and convenient use, and is an ideal disinfectant.

Preparation method of quinine hydrochloride

The invention discloses a preparation method of quinine hydrochloride. The method of the invention comprises the following steps: transforming quinine sulfate to quinine, then dispersing the quinine into a dispersing agent, adding hydrochloric acid or introducing hydrogen chloride gas to react, and the quinine hydrochloride is obtained through the method of crystallization. Only the common acids and bases, and the common solvents with low toxicity and low price are used in the method of the invention, and the chemical reagents with high toxicity are not used. The method has high yield which is same as or close to the theoretical yield, and the yield can reach 110 to 115% measured in terms of the quinine. Further, the method is environmentally friendly. The whole preparation process of theinvention has simple and convenient operation and low cost, and is beneficial to the production amplification.
